To start, let’s define what self-care means. Self-care refers to the intentional acts of taking care of one’s own physical, emotional, and mental health. It’s about making conscious choices to prioritize your own well-being, rather than simply going through the motions of daily life. With that in mind, let’s dive into Anabella Galeano’s secrets to better self-care.

  1. Start Small: One of the biggest mistakes people make when it comes to self-care is trying to make drastic changes all at once. However, this approach often leads to burnout and frustration. Instead, Anabella recommends starting small, with tiny, manageable changes that can be incorporated into daily life. For example, taking a few minutes each day to stretch or practice deep breathing exercises can make a big difference in overall well-being.

  2. Listen to Your Body: Your body has a unique way of communicating with you, and it’s essential to listen to its needs. Anabella suggests paying attention to physical sensations, such as hunger, fatigue, or pain, and responding accordingly. For instance, if you’re feeling tired, it may be a sign that you need to take a break and rest, rather than pushing through and exacerbating the fatigue.

  3. Prioritize Sleep: Sleep is a fundamental aspect of self-care, and yet, it’s often neglected in our busy lives. Anabella emphasizes the importance of getting enough sleep, aiming for 7-9 hours each night, to help the body and mind recharge. Establishing a consistent sleep schedule, creating a relaxing bedtime routine, and avoiding screens before bed can all help improve sleep quality.

  4. Nourish Your Body: What we eat has a significant impact on our overall health and well-being. Anabella recommends focusing on whole, nutrient-dense foods, such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ins, to provide the body with the necessary fuel to function optimally. Additionally, staying hydrated by drinking plenty of water throughout the day is essential for maintaining energy levels and supporting overall health.

  5. Practice Mindfulness: Mindfulness is the practice of being present in the moment, without judgment. Anabella suggests incorporating mindfulness techniques, such as meditation or yoga, into daily life to help reduce stress and increase self-awareness. Even just a few minutes of mindfulness practice each day can have a profound impact on mental and emotional well-being.

  6. Connect with Nature: Spending time in nature has been shown to have numerous benefits for both physical and mental health. Anabella recommends taking time to connect with nature, whether it’s walking in a park, hiking in the woods, or simply sitting in a garden or on a balcony with plants. Being in nature can help reduce stress, improve mood, and increase feelings of calm and well-being.

  7. Set Healthy Boundaries: Setting healthy boundaries is essential for maintaining emotional and mental well-being. Anabella suggests learning to say “no” to things that drain energy and saying “yes” to things that nourish and replenish it. This may involve setting limits with others, prioritizing self-care activities, and taking time for yourself when needed.

  8. Practice Self-Compassion: Self-compassion is the practice of treating oneself with kindness, understanding, and patience. Anabella recommends cultivating self-compassion by acknowledging that it’s okay to make mistakes, being gentle with oneself, and practicing self-forgiveness. This can involve writing yourself a kind letter, taking a relaxing bath, or engaging in other activities that promote feelings of self-love and acceptance.

  9. Engage in Activities That Bring Joy: Doing things that bring joy and happiness is essential for maintaining a positive outlook and overall sense of well-being. Anabella suggests making time for activities that spark joy, whether it’s reading, painting, dancing, or playing music. Engaging in creative pursuits can help reduce stress, improve mood, and increase feelings of fulfillment and purpose.

  10. Seek Support: Finally, Anabella emphasizes the importance of seeking support from others when needed. This may involve talking to a trusted friend or family member, seeking the help of a mental health professional, or joining a support group. Having a strong support network can help provide a sense of security, reduce feelings of loneliness, and increase overall well-being.

  11. Practice Consistency: Consistency is key when it comes to self-care. Anabella recommends making self-care a priority by incorporating it into daily life, rather than treating it as an afterthought. This may involve scheduling self-care activities into your daily planner, setting reminders, or finding an accountability partner to help stay on track.
